Abstract
Distributed random access memory in a programmable logic device uses configuration RAM bits as bits of the distributed RAM. A single write path is used to provide both configuration data and user write data. Selection circuitry, such as a multiplexer, is used to determine whether the single write path carries configuration data or user write data. In another aspect of the invention, the configuration RAM bits are used as to construct a shift register by adding pass transistors to chain the configuration RAM bits together, and clocking alternate pass transistors with two clocks 180° out of phase with one another.
